2017-3-2 The feldspar minerals and quartz were separated from each other by flotation of feldspar minerals and depression of quartz minerals. Both feldspar and quartz in amine flotation and in the absence of HF need not be floated at pH less than 4. However, in the presence of HF feldspar is floated at pH 2–3 while quartz does not float.
